A report by WTAJ indicates that police have added additional charges against Tiffany Cabrera, Warner Almanzar and Jose Reynoso for allegedly stealing from PA Skill machines. The report says that an employee of Deleo Games Inc, based in Altoona discovered that more than $11,700 was missing from a Skills machine at the Unimart on Aaron drive in Ferguson Twp, in mid October. This is on top of other skills games thefts that occurred. The suspects were identified by photos given to police. The employee said that 2 of the thieves would unlock the machine, while the third distracted the employee. They are all locked up in the Centre County jail.
